Output e2a9777938ca68bc0d872d9f4fa7a4f4cfe26e6e43731dcdb1ce91ef7cba1519:0

value
643993000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84b7a77c9caa774212d0c7021f96775fb92692de OP_EQUAL
address
MKzuSGkpum9eH8N6QyLcLEHzQpBg8CrPJy
transaction
e2a9777938ca68bc0d872d9f4fa7a4f4cfe26e6e43731dcdb1ce91ef7cba1519
spent
true